CME: 2 hours
This two-part symposium, sponsored by the ASCRS Research Foundation, will cover all aspects of research in colorectal diseases. In the first part, we brought together surgical leaders to address the challenges and provide guidance in creating an academic research career. In the second part, we will hear from content experts who will highlight the leading edge of colorectal research.
